Micro-nano optical stickers are designed with precision at the micro and nano levels, incorporating optical elements that manipulate light in unique ways. These stickers can be engineered with nanostructures to exhibit optical properties like diffraction, interference, or polarization to achieve specific visual effects when interacting with light.

 Micro-nano optical stickers are increasingly utilized for security and anti-counterfeiting purposes. Their intricate optical features make them challenging to replicate, providing a reliable method for authenticating products and documents.
